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14356621997 711409375 3552049 5061
64349712 1554 7400868915
64349712 1554 7400868915
985 393050152 75
All about undefined
Interested in learning more?
64349712 1554 7400868915
985 393050152 75
See more
7684 484 8000
15631541 58948565 18318 15481285 4427
See more
559146 76 85033
75352 498 65 3647
See more